Prima TV, a privately owned company based in Romania and part of Clever Media Network, was founded in 1997. Employing approximately 200 individuals, the company reported $12.5M in revenue as of 2024. Functioning as a tier 1 media tech buyer, Prima TV specializes in broadcast television and radio services, operating as a Romanian broadcaster.

News Summary:

On May 7, 2026, Egyptian billionaire Naguib Sawiris and Franco-Tunisian media executive Tarak Ben Ammar completed the sale of the digital terrestrial television multiplex operated by their Italian media company Prima TV to telecommunications engineering firm Syes for approximately €2.5 million, marking another step in Sawiris’ gradual exit from legacy media investments. Previously, on May 4, 2026, the company confirmed the divestment, with the broadcast transmission business having generated cumulative losses exceeding €29 million across the two years leading up to the sale. Italy’s Communications Authority (AgCom) approved the transaction.
